Sisukord:
Video: DIY MusiLED, muusika sünkroonitud LED-id ühe klõpsuga Windowsi ja Linuxi rakendusega (32-bitine ja 64-bitine). Lihtne taastada, lihtne kasutada, lihtne teisaldada: 3 sammu
2024 Autor: John Day | [email protected]. Viimati modifitseeritud: 2024-01-30 08:49
See projekt aitab teil ühendada 18 LED-i (6 punast + 6 sinist + 6 kollast) oma Arduino plaadiga ja analüüsida arvuti helikaardi reaalajasignaale ning edastada need LED-idele, et need löögiefektide järgi valgustada (Snare, Kõrge müts, löök). Ma nägin selles osas mõningaid juhendeid, kuid enamik neist on liiga mahukad ja neil on raske välja selgitada koode algajatele või isetegijatele, kes soovivad valmis DIY projekti, selle asemel et nad peaksid tundide kaupa lähtekoode sirvima, et neist mingit tähendust teha. Võite kasutada ka 6 smd 5050 riba või individuaalselt programmeeritavat RBG WS28xx seeriat. Kuid nende toitenõuded on erinevad, seega vaadake nende andmelehelt, kui olete nendega uus.
Kui te ei soovi lähtekoodi ümber askeldada ja soovite selle kiiresti kasutusele võtta, olete õigel lehel. Teostame 3 (kolme) lihtsat sammu - osade hankimine, nende ühendamine ja Windowsi rakenduse käivitamine, et teie muusika muusika üles tõsta. Parim osa on see, et selleks ei pea te töötlemist ega teeke installima ning saate kasutada mis tahes soovitud meediumipleierit ja mängida/peatada/peatada/edasi/tagasi kerida otse meediumipleierist, ilma et peaksite koodi muutma ega muret tekitama meediafailide laienduste kohta. Mis tahes heli teie helikaardi kaudu analüüsitakse, kui rakendus *.exe töötab, isegi kui mängite/vaatate YouTube'i/filme või isegi siis, kui teie tüdruksõber/poiss -sõber karjub Skype'i kõne kaudu. *Veenduge, et sulgete rakenduse intiimsetel hetkedel*. !! Nalja peale !! Alustame ja viime projekti lõpule vähem kui 20 minutiga.
1. samm: OSADE HANKIMINE
Te vajate
a) Arduino. (Ma kasutasin Mega2560, mis mul oli lamades, saate kasutada UNO -d või mõnda muud, millel on vähemalt 6 PWM tihvti).
b) 3,5 mm LED -id - 18 nos. (6 kollast + 6 punast + 6 sinist)., VÕI, LED -RIBA (kasutage ainult siis, kui teate, mida teete).
c) Takistid - 220 või 150 oomi * 6
d) leivaplaat / prototüüpplaat ja palju M-M hüppajakaableid (piisab umbes 15-st).
2. samm: OSADE ÜHENDAMINE
LED -ide suurem jalg tähistab +ve (positiivne) anoodi ja lühem jalg on -ve (negatiivne) katood.
Asetage valgusdioodid piisavalt kaugele ja paigutage need parema efekti saavutamiseks hästi. Ühendage Arduino PWM -i poolne GND -tihvt leivaplaadi maapinnaga. Ühendage takistid LED -i katoodijalaga järjestikku maandusega; ja PWM tihvtid arduinost LED -ide anoodijalani. {Võite takisti väärtustega ringi käia, kuid veenduge, et LED -id ei töötaks ilma takistuseta, vastasel juhul võite need põletada}. Parema selguse saamiseks vaadake esitatud diagrammi. Kasutasin skeemi vasakpoolsete LED -ide esimese 3 komplekti jaoks kolme 220 oomi takistit; Ja ülejäänud 150 LED -i jaoks kolm 150 oomi.
Kui olete LED -de ja takistite seadistamise leivalaual seadistanud, ühendage Arduino oma Windowsi arvutiga. Avage Arduino IDE, avage Fail> Näited> Firmata> StandardFirmata ja laadige näidisvisand oma Arduinole üles. ! VALMIS!
3. samm: parandage oma muusikat
Lähtekoodi saamiseks külastage minu ajaveebi https://knowledgeofthings.com/diy-musical-lights- … ---------------------------- -------------------------------------------------- ----------------
Kui teil on rakendusega probleeme, veenduge, et teie Arduino oleks sisse lülitatud "COM3", kui ei, siis kommenteerige allpool oma seeria-/pordinumbrit ja laadin üles teie jaoks mõeldud rakenduse. Kui Tx/Rx tuled vilguvad, kuid valgusdioodid mitte, siis kontrollige veel kord valgusdioodide polaarsust ja lahtist või vale juhtmestikku.
Märkus: - LINUX & MAC kasutajatele - Ärge muretsege, ma laadin teile üles ka konkreetse rakenduse, lihtsalt kommenteerige allpool oma seerianumbrit. Windowsi 32-bitistel kasutajatel palutakse installida Java 8.
Lisamärkus.- Kui te ei mängi midagi, millel on heli, kuid ühendate siiski oma arduino ja käivitate rakenduse, siis hakkavad kollased ja punased LED-id vilkuma juhuslikult, näidates, et ühendus on õige ja rakendus töötab. Seda saab teha kohe pärast kolme sammu, et olla kindel, et järgisite seda lihtsat juhendit. Vabandan oma grammatiliste vigade pärast, inglise keel pole minu esimene keel. Loodan kindlasti, et keegi kordab seda kuuel smd5050 või ws28xx ribal. Kui kellelgi teist on, siis jagage seda ka minuga.
Soovitan:
Kuidas luua Linuxi alglaadimisseade (ja kuidas seda kasutada): 10 sammu
Linuxi alglaadimisseadme loomine (ja selle kasutamine): see on lihtne sissejuhatus Linuxi, täpsemalt Ubuntu, kasutamise alustamiseks
Klaviatuuri süstimine/Sisestage oma parool ühe klõpsuga!: 4 sammu (piltidega)
Klaviatuuri süstimine/automaatne tippige oma parool ühe klõpsuga !: Paroolid on rasked … ja turvalise salasõna meeldejätmine on veelgi raskem! Peale selle, kui teil on kaasas keerukas parool, võtab selle sisestamine aega. Kuid ärge kartke mu sõpru, mul on sellele lahendus! Lõin väikese automaatse sisestusmasina, mis töötab
Muusika reaktiivne valgus -- Kuidas teha ülilihtne muusika reaktiivvalgus, et muuta lauaarvuti ahvatlevaks: 5 sammu (piltidega)
Muusika reaktiivne valgus || Kuidas teha ülilihtne muusika reaktiivvalgus, et muuta töölaud lauaarvutiks: Hei, mis on poisid, täna ehitame väga huvitava projekti. Täna ehitame muusikale reageeriva valguse. LED muudab heledust vastavalt bass, mis on tegelikult madala sagedusega helisignaal. See on väga lihtne ehitada. Me
Oranž PI kuidas: Koostage Sunxi tööriist Windowsi jaoks Windowsi jaoks: 14 sammu (piltidega)
Orange PI HowTo: Koostage Sunxi tööriist Windowsi jaoks Windowsi jaoks: EELTINGIMUSED: Teil on vaja Windowsi (lauaarvuti). Interneti -ühendus. Oranž PI -plaat. Viimane on valikuline, kuid olen kindel, et teil on see juba olemas. Vastasel juhul ei loe te seda juhendit. Kui ostate oranži PI patu
Muusika sünkroonitud valgusetenduse tegemine stoppliigutusega: 6 sammu
Tehke muusika sünkroonitud valgusetendus Stop Motioni abil: nii et põhimõtteliselt, kui teile meeldivad need YouTube'i filmid, mille jõulutuled on lauluga sünkroonitud, on see juhend Juhendatav teie jaoks! See võtab arvesse arvutiga juhitavate tulede kontseptsiooni ja muudab selle lihtsamaks (minu arvates, kuna ma pole seda kunagi teinud